光速调控中的信息速度问题研究

摘要
利用不同的技术手段实现光速的调控是最近几年的研究热点问题之一。伴随光速调控技术的深入研究,在慢光以及超光速情况下信息速度的问题也成为人们关注的重要方面。利用非解析点的方法研究了在红宝石晶体中慢光情况下,以及C60中超光速情况下信息的传递速度。研究结果表明,无论在慢光情况下还是超光速情况下,在实验测量的精度范围内信息的传播速度都小于真空中光速c。这说明观察到的超光速现象并不违反因果关系,虽然群速度超过真空中光速,但信息的传递速度不受群速度的影响。
Abstract
In recent years, researches about the controllable group velocity using differerent methods arouse great interest among researchers. With the development of controllable slow and fast light propagation, discussions about the information speed under abnormal light velocity have been reported. In this work, the information speed in ruby crystal and C60 solution under the slow and fast light conditons are discussed respectively. The results demonstrate that, in our experiment, the information speed is smaller than light speed in a vacuum, although the light group velocity may exceed the light speed in a vacuum. This result is in accordance with the causulty.
